区块链技术自从诞生以来,已经改变了许多行业的运作方式,尤其是在金融、供应链管理和数据安全等领域。随着技术的进步,出现了越来越多的区块链平台,各自具有不同的特性和优势。
在这篇文章中,我们将探讨当前市场上最受欢迎的区块链平台,它们如何运作,以及它们在不同应用场景中的表现。
一、以太坊(Ethereum)
以太坊是目前最知名的区块链平台之一,由Vitalik Buterin于2015年推出。与比特币主要用于数字货币的功能不同,以太坊更多的是作为一个智能合约和去中心化应用的基础平台。它允许开发者创建和部署自己的去中心化应用(DApps),这些应用通过智能合约来自动执行合约条款。
以太坊的关键特性在于它的可编程性。开发者可以使用Solidity语言编写智能合约,从而创建多样化的应用场景,包括去中心化金融(DeFi)、非同质化代币(NFT)和更多的应用。这些应用通过以太坊网络的安全性和透明性受益。
以太坊的去中心化性质使得它有助于消除中介,从而降低交易成本,提高交易效率。尽管以太坊2.0的更新在技术上面临许多挑战和质疑,但它依然是目前区块链平台中最受欢迎的选择之一。
二、超级账本(Hyperledger)
超级账本是一个开源的区块链平台,由Linux基金会主办,旨在推动跨行业的区块链技术发展。与以太坊不同,超级账本是一个企业级的平台,专注于权限管理和私密性,适合需要高安全性和控制的企业使用。
超级账本平台包括多个项目,例如Hyperledger Fabric、Hyperledger Sawtooth和Hyperledger Iroha,每一个项目都有其独特的功能和用途。例如,Hyperledger Fabric是一个模块化的区块链框架,允许企业根据自身需求定制区块链。
由于其灵活性,超级账本特别适合金融服务、供应链跟踪和医疗健康等行业,使得企业能够在控制访问的同时,享受区块链技术带来的透明性和数据安全性。
三、EOS.IO
EOS.IO是一个高性能的区块链平台,专注于去中心化应用的开发。由Block.one公司推出,EOS.IO以其可扩展性和低延迟的交易著称。相较于以太坊,EOS.IO采用了不同的共识机制,即Delegated Proof of Stake(DPoS),使得网络能够处理每秒数千次交易。
EOS的设计目标是解决许多区块链平台的性能问题,因此在开发DApps时,开发者能够获得更高的灵活性和更低的成本。此外,EOS还提供了一个动态的名称系统,使得用户能够方便地在平台上进行交互。
尽管EOS.IO面临一些关于中心化的批评,但其强大的性能和开发者友好的特性吸引了许多开发者选择该平台来构建他们的去中心化应用。
四、波卡(Polkadot)
波卡是一个可互操作的区块链平台,通过“中继链”实现多个区块链的连接。波卡的设计理念是允许不同的区块链之间进行无缝的通信和数据交换,这种互操作性是区块链技术的一大挑战。
波卡允许开发者创建自己的“平行链”,这些平行链能够共享波卡的安全性,同时又保持一定的独立性。这种灵活性使得开发者能够根据不同需求创建各种应用,同时提高了各区块链之间的协作效率。
波卡的生态系统正在快速发展,许多项目和团队正在加入这个平台,以利用其独特的互操作性和安全性,同时推动区块链技术的进一步发展。
五、常见问题
区块链平台的选择标准是什么?
选择合适的区块链平台是开发去中心化应用成功与否的关键因素。以下是几个主要的选择标准:
安全性:安全性是选择区块链平台的首要考虑。平台的共识机制、协议设计和最大化的防火墙措施是防止数位资产被盗取的重要因素。
可扩展性:这个标准影响每秒能够处理的交易数量。为了提高用户体验,需要选择可支持高交易量的平台。许多区块链平台(例如EOS)通过改进的共识机制提高了可扩展性。
开发友好性:平台是否易于开发加速了项目的进展,需要考虑的因素包括是否有详尽的文档、社区支持以及开发工具的可用性。
成本:交易成本和记录数据的费用都是需要考虑的影响因素。区块链平台的拥堵情况可能直接影响交易的费用,因此需要选择合理的平台以降低开支。
选择合适的平台需综合考虑这些因素,还需要根据自身项目的特性,结合商业目标进行判断。
区块链平台在各行业的应用案例有哪些?
区块链技术在多个行业的应用变得越来越普遍。以下是几个行业以及应用案例:
金融服务:区块链的最初应用可以追溯到金融行业,通过提供降低成本和提高透明度的解决方案,如Ripple网络的跨境支付功能,已经越来越多地被金融机构所接受。
供应链管理:Wal-Mart及其他公司使用区块链追踪食品从农场到零售环节的每一步,增加了供应链的透明度和效率,确保食品来源的可追溯性。
医疗健康:区块链可以确保医疗数据的安全和隐私,像MedRec这样的项目能够高效地管理患者记录,避免信息的重复和失真。
投票系统:区块链技术被提供商广泛应用于投票和身份验证,为选举过程提供透明和安全的解决方案。
通过这些应用案例,我们可以看到区块链技术的有效性和潜力,未来会有更多行业受益于这项革命性的技术。
区块链平台的安全性如何保证?
区块链的安全性是其核心优点之一,但随着技术的发展和应用的拓展,安全问题也层出不穷。为了保证安全性,区块链平台可以通过以下方式做到:
共识机制:选择较为先进的共识机制(如PoS、DPoS等)能够增强网络的安全性,阻止网络攻击者通过操控节点达到攻击目的。
智能合约审核:在部署智能合约之前,通过专业的代码审核机构进行代码审核,以发现潜在的安全漏洞。
数据加密:区块链数据通过加密措施确保用户隐私,只有授权用户能够访问特定信息,从而降低数据被泄漏的风险。
及时升级:定期对区块链协议进行升级和维护,确保平台始终处于一个安全的状态,抵御新兴的网络攻击方案。
综合运用这些手段,可以降低区块链平台的安全风险,确保其在实际应用环境中的稳定性及安全性。
区块链平台的未来趋势是什么?
随着区块链技术的不断发展及其应用的扩展,未来的趋势也逐渐清晰。以下是几个主要趋势:
跨链技术的崛起:不同的区块链平台之间互操作性的需求日益增长,波卡和Cosmos等平台将逐渐成为行业的重要组成部分,促进多链环境的形成。
法规合规性:随着政府和监管者对区块链和数字货币的关注加深,未来的区块链平台将更加注重遵循法规和合规性。
隐私保护技术的提升:私人资产保护需求的上升从而发展出更多隐私中心的区块链解决方案,如Zcash和Monero等强调隐私安全的项目。
去中心化金融(DeFi)的持续增长:DeFi市场在2020年经历了爆炸式增长,并有望在未来继续吸引更多资金流入,推动整个区块链生态的壮大。
以上趋势不仅表明了区块链行业的未来方向,也暗示着我们还需持续关注技术和市场的变化,抓住行业发展带来的机遇。
综合来看,区块链平台的多样化使得不同行业和企业能够根据自己的需求选择合适的技术支持,推动行业的创新与发展。在理解各大平台特性的基础上,未来更能有效地利用区块链技术所带来的便捷与安全性。
